What to Expect From the Housing Market in 2025

Predicting the future of the housing market is always a challenge, but there are some trends that suggest where things might be heading in 2025. One trend to watch is the continued popularity of hybrid work, which could lead to more individuals seeking out homes in rural areas. Additionally, there is a growing demand on energy-efficiency features in new construction, as consumers become more conscious of their environmental impact. Furthermore, automation is expected to play an even bigger role in the housing market, with smart homes becoming increasingly widespread.
